Common H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

Several HVAC problems call for emergency service. Recognizing these problems can assist you know when to require expert help: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system quits working entirely, particularly throughout severe weather condition, it's more than simply an hassle-- it can be hazardous. Our emergency HVAC professionals can diagnose and fix the problem immediately, restoring your home's convenience and safety.
  • Unusual Noises or Smells
    Odd seem like banging, grinding, or screeching from your HVAC system often signal a serious mechanical problem that could lead to bigger problems if not dealt with quickly. Similarly, uncommon smells may indicate electrical issues or perhaps gas leakages. Our professional HVAC professionals can recognize these problems and make necessary repair work before they become hazardous.
  • Water Leaks
    Water dripping from your HVAC system can harm your home and cause mold growth. Our specialists locate the source of leakages and fix them properly to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leakages reduce your a/c unit's cooling capability and can hurt the environment. They require professional attention as refrigerant dealing with calls for specialized training and equipment.
  • Electrical Issues
    Issues with electrical elements in your HVAC system position fire risks and must be addressed immediately by qualified experts. Our HVAC specialists have the training to safely repair electrical issues.

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Restricted airflow makes your system work more difficult and decreases convenience. Our HVAC contractors identify air flow issues, whether triggered by duct problems, filthy filters, or fan issues.
  • Uneven Heating or Cooling
    If some spaces are too hot while others are too cold, you might have duct issues, insulation concerns, or an improperly sized system. Our professional HVAC contractors can identify these problems and suggest options.
  • Short Cycling
    When your system switches on and off frequently, it wastes energy and wears parts faster. Our HVAC professionals can identify whether the issue originates from a clogged up filter, inappropriate thermostat settings, or something more severe.
  • High Energy Bills
    Sudden increases in energy expenses typically indicate HVAC inefficiency. Our contractors perform energy effectiveness assessments to determine the cause and suggest improvements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ems ought to help control indoor humidity. If your home feels too damp in summer season or too dry in winter, our HVAC contractors can advise solutions to enhance convenience and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    In some cases what seems like a system failure is in fact a thermostat issue. Our HVAC professionals can repair or change thermostats and assist you upgrade to programmable or wise designs for much better convenience control and energy cost savings.
